Cancer Bats Have Taste Of Chaos

Cancer Bats will be one of the bands to play next year's Rockstar Energy Drink Taste Of Chaos Tour. The Toronto hardcore group will join headliners Thursday and Bring Me The Horizon, Four Year Strong and Pierce The Veil at shows throughout North America from February to April.
